## Deployment

Doclint, our documentation linter, deploys as a single container behind the internal gateway. New contractors should deploy to the sandbox cluster first and run the smoke suite before promoting. The linter picks up rule packs at boot, so a restart is required after any rule change. At startup it loads the following configuration values.

settings of fafog-haduf:
ZORIX_PIN=4648
ZORIX_METRICS_HOST=metrics.zorix.paliqsys.corp
ZORIX_LOG_LEVEL=info
ZORIX_TENANT=druix

**Handover: Thornwick serverless handlers — cold start tuning**

Handing this over mid-stream. The Thornwick invoice handlers were seeing multi-second cold starts, so I added provisioned warm instances and trimmed the dependency bundle. Latency is acceptable now, but the warm pool sizing is a guess — revisit after the next traffic review. Don't touch the memory tier without re-running the benchmark suite. The settings I left in place are these.

service settings:
PRAIX_LOG_LEVEL=error
PRAIX_METRICS_HOST=metrics.praix.qorvelcorp.corp
PRAIX_POOL_SIZE=16

Ticket #— Floor 9 Opening Prep, Brindlemoor House

Hi facilities folks, Floor 9 opens to staff next Monday and we need a few things squared away before then. Lift access is live, but the two side doors by the kitchenette are still on the old lock config — please reprogram them before Friday. Also, signage for the quiet rooms hasn't arrived, so pop up the temporary printed ones for now. Until the badge readers sync, the interim door code for Floor 9 is below.

door code, bajop-bajog: bdg-DSWAC-43621

Quarterly Planning Note — Divestiture of the Coastal Tooling Unit

For the finance team: the sale of the Coastal Tooling unit to Pellmark Industries remains on track for close in Q3. Please finalize the carve-out balance sheet, reconcile intercompany positions, and prepare the working-capital adjustment schedule by month-end. Audit support requests should be prioritized. For planning purposes, note the following sensitive item:

internal memo for hawef-kahif: The finance team signed off on a budget of $25.9 million for Project Sorox. The renewal with Pelokek Logistics closes at $51.7 million a year, 52 percent below the last contract.